Marketing in the medical device industry involves promoting and selling medical devices such as diagnostic equipment, surgical instruments, implantable devices, and other medical technologies Unlike consumer products, medical devices are subject to strict regulations and standards set by governing bodies like the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) This means that marketing strategies in this industry must be carefully crafted to ensure compliance with these regulations while effectively reaching target audiences.
One of the main reasons why marketing is essential in the medical device industry is to raise awareness about new products and technologies With rapid advancements in medical technology, companies must continually innovate and develop new devices to stay competitive Marketing helps to create buzz around new products, generate interest from healthcare providers and patients, and ultimately drive sales.
Another key aspect of marketing in the medical device industry is educating healthcare professionals about the benefits and features of different devices Medical devices are complex products that require specialized training to use effectively Therefore, companies must provide healthcare providers with the information and resources they need to understand how to use their products safely and efficiently This can include training programs, instructional videos, and detailed product manuals.

One of the challenges of marketing in the medical device industry is navigating the complex regulatory environment Medical devices are subject to strict regulations around safety, efficacy, and marketing claims Companies must ensure that their marketing materials are accurate, compliant, and transparent to avoid facing fines or legal consequences This requires close collaboration between marketing teams, regulatory affairs experts, and legal professionals to ensure that all materials meet regulatory requirements.
Another challenge in marketing medical devices is reaching target audiences in a crowded and competitive market Healthcare providers are bombarded with information about new products and technologies every day, making it difficult for companies to stand out This is where targeted marketing strategies come into play, such as developing personalized messaging, leveraging digital marketing channels, and engaging with key opinion leaders in the industry.
